Purchasing the car, getting the title, and registering the vehicle was a whole 'nother can of worms that sucked ass.

The Readers Digest Version (if you can believe that): I purchased the car from a guy living in KY who was leasing the vehicle. This meant he did not have "clear title" until he paid off the lease (which he required my money to do). Then he had to get the title from the leasing agency in the dealership's name. Then they had to signed it over to him. Then he had to register the vehicle in his name and pay sales taxes on the vehicle. Then he had to get his own KY title. Then he had to sign it over to me. Then I had to get an Ohio title. Then I had to get it inspected and E-checked (a waste of time). Then I had to get my own temp tag so I could order PDTSHVL. Thirteen million trips to the BMV later, I now know not to a) buy a car from an out of state resident b) buy a car from someone who does not already have clear title.
